    I've been wanting this one for a while. Contains the first appearance of Red Sonya (Sonja) in "The Shadow of the Vulture." It's a historical adventure that Roy Thomas converted into a Conan story in CtB 23 and 24.

     

    This issue is a bonus for the REH collector as it has a second story under one of Howard's pen names Patrick Ervin. This one is a Sailor Steve Costigan boxing story (with the name changed to Dennis Dorgan since Costigan was a Fiction House property).
